4 Hour Body Slow Carb Diet - Week 3

The 4 Hour Body slow carb diet is still working for me.

I started this about two (2) weeks ago or so and, entering week 3, I am down from a starting weight of 225 to 217, as of this morning (Monday).

This was amazing to me, given that my free day was on Saturday, and included both pizza and ice cream (with M&Ms!). On Sunday, I adhered to the diet strictly, and found that I wasn't very hungry most of the day. I had beans and eggs for breakfast on Sunday, and a salad with beans for lunch. But after that I wasn't hungry for the rest of the day, and but for a handful of almonds, while driving back from the cottage, I did not eat again.

So far so good.

As I have said before, I am not trying to do anything different as far as physical activity, while I do this diet. It's a controlled experiment. I do whatever activity I would normally do. I don't want to confound it by changing two variables, only one.

This weekend did include a couple of decent walks, some wind surfing, and some leisure swimming. But overall it was nothing out of the ordinary.
